Recognizing Glaucoma and Its Effect On Vision



When you consider vision loss, glaucoma mightn't be the first condition that comes to mind, however it is among the leading reasons.

Glaucoma is typically called the "quiet burglar of sight" since it can advance without obvious symptoms. This problem typically includes damage to the optic nerve as a result of increased pressure in the eye. Consequently, you might experience gradual loss of field of vision, making it difficult to discover until substantial damage has taken place.



Early detection is vital, as unattended glaucoma can result in irreversible vision loss. Regular eye exams are important for monitoring eye pressure and examining your optic nerve wellness.

Sorts Of Glaucoma Surgical Treatment and Their Advantages



If you're dealing with the difficulties of glaucoma and conventional treatments aren't enough, surgical procedure may be a viable alternative for you.

There are a number of kinds of glaucoma surgery, each with unique benefits. Trabeculectomy develops a brand-new drain path, minimizing eye stress properly.

Tube shunt surgical treatment involves positioning a tiny tube to help drain pipes fluid, supplying advantages for even more intricate instances.

Minimally intrusive glaucoma surgery (MIGS) utilizes small instruments for quicker healing and less threat, making it appealing if you're searching for a much less intrusive method.

Laser treatments, like careful laser trabeculoplasty, can additionally decrease eye stress with minimal pain.

Each option has its benefits, and reviewing these with your eye treatment expert can help you pick the best path forward.
